Role Overview

As Harvey scales its post-sales function across EMEA, we are hiring a Legal Engineer Manager - Product Specialist to lead and grow the Product Specialist team in London. This role was created to provide senior leadership and strategic direction to a team of Product Specialists who support existing customers in maximising their use of the Harvey platform.

Harvey’s Legal Engineer - Product Specialists are experienced lawyers from top-tier firms who leverage their legal expertise to help customers seamlessly integrate Harvey into their daily workflows - driving adoption, increasing utilisation, and supporting long-term expansion and renewal. Legal Engineer - Product Specialists collaborate closely with Harvey’s Customer Success Managers to drive all facets of the post-sales strategy. They develop consultative relationships with law firm partners, associates, innovation teams, and in-house counsel, serving as trusted advisors on how Harvey’s AI solutions can enhance legal effectiveness and efficiency.

Legal Engineer - Product Specialists draw on their legal training and practice experience to ask thoughtful questions, uncover adoption barriers, and develop tailored strategies that build credibility with customers. They partner with Customer Success Managers to communicate Harvey’s value through a mix of large group sessions, small workshops, and one-on-one conversations.

What You'll Do

Lead and develop a team of Legal Engineers - Product Specialists, providing coaching, performance management, and career development support. Own the post-implementation customer relationship from a legal engineering perspective, ensuring law firm and in-house clients are effectively onboarded, trained, and supported on an ongoing basis Act as the senior escalation point for complex or strategic customer engagements, bringing deep product and legal expertise Partner with Account Management and Sales to identify expansion opportunities, support renewals, and contribute to retention strategy Collaborate with the Product team to surface customer feedback, advocate for platform improvements, and keep the team informed of new features and roadmap developments Define and iterate on team processes, playbooks, and frameworks to build a scalable and high-performing function

What You Have

Qualified lawyer with 7+ PQE, with experience in a law firm or in-house legal environment Prior experience managing or mentoring a team, with a track record of developing talent and driving performance Deep familiarity with legal technology and AI tools, with an ability to quickly develop and demonstrate platform expertise Strong commercial instincts and the ability to engage credibly with senior stakeholders at law firms and in-house legal teams Excellent communication and presentation skills, with experience running training, workshops, or client-facing product sessions Comfort operating in a fast-paced, high-growth environment with a pragmatic, solutions-oriented approach
